Программист С++
Требования
Местоположение и тип занятости
Компания
Описание вакансии
О компании и команде
«Цифра роботикс» — один из шести дивизионов группы компаний «Цифра» — IT-разработчика №1 в российской промышленности по версии Tadviser. Мы разрабатываем и внедряем решения для роботизации открытых и подземных горных работ. Наши технологии дистанционного управления и автономной работы совместимы с оборудованием БелАЗ, Камаз, Terex, Epiroc,CAT, Bucyrus, P&H.
Ожидания от кандидата
Чем нужно будет заниматься:
- Разработка ПО для модуля управления автономным самосвалом;
- Организация и проведение рефакторинга существующего функционала;
- Разработка unit-тестов;
- Участие в постановке требований / формулировании ТЗ на программные модули, декомпозиция задач;
- Разработка API для организации передачи данных с роботизированным комплексом;
- Разработка внутренних инструментов.
Чего мы ожидаем от кандидата:
- Python 2/3 на хорошем уровне, C/C++/Java базовые знания или C/C++/Java на хорошем уровне Pyton 2/3 базовые знания;
- HTML, CSS, JavaScript, flask, SQL базовые знания;
- Уверенные знания классических алгоритмов и структур данных;
- Умение поддерживать чужой код и проектировать свой, представление о паттернах программирования;
- Понимание принципов многопоточного программирования;
- Знание протоколов TCP, UDP, IP. Понимание принципов организации сетей;
- Уверенные знания ОС Linux, умение работать в командной строке;
- Умение работать с NoSQL базами данных (redis, mongoDB)/
Условия работы
💯От нас - интересные проекты, профессиональная и дружелюбная команда, адекватный менеджмент, соблюдение всех требований ТК РФ.
⭐️Проекты федерального и международного уровня
⭐️Полис ДМС и страхование жизни по окончании испытательного срока.
⭐️Предоставляем технику для работы своих сотрудников.
⭐️Входим в перечень аккредитованных Минцифрой IT компаний.